Output 8e655cae253a85fc40cd7cb08ad1f0ad9dff8b69d2a407609b0900a12cbbd4b8:0

value
407665603
script pubkey
OP_0 OP_PUSHBYTES_20 4ffdbc00f68fe5bb2b9500f7ff3cf075b0f737f9
address
bc1qfl7mcq8k3ljmk2u4qrml708swkc0wdlegqd9aw
transaction
8e655cae253a85fc40cd7cb08ad1f0ad9dff8b69d2a407609b0900a12cbbd4b8
confirmations
135246
spent
true